Search for IFSC Code, Bank or Branch Name and Address

Branches of Punjab National Bank in Channour, Himachal Pradesh
Branch IFSC Address
Channour PUNB0939700 Punjab National Bank Channour Tehsil Dadasiba Hp Chano 177113